i've created a unit test to reproduce the problem since we can test it more
directly and deterministicly, but i can't seem to make it happen. i'm attaching
my unit test patch just in case you are camille can see what i'm missing.
if i understand it, the problem is that we are losing proposals that are
received between the NEWLEADER and the UPDATE, but a follower doesn't send out
any acks during that time, so it's okay to lose them. am i misunderstanding the
problem?
